1.变量类型要一致 Java是一种强类型语言,注意使用的变量类型是否相同,要根据变量类型来决定next后面的后缀 2.变量类型不一致解决办法(强制转换) 强转是同类型发生的类型转换,不同类型通过toXXX转换,帮助我们提供to方法,通过to方法决定什么类型转成什么类型。 除了char和int 是java自动强制,其它都要通过强化或转化方法来进行类型的变换 转化方法:转化类型的全称大写. parse转换类型 在Java编程中出现整型数的不匹配,指存储空间大小问题(Int 4个字节, long 8个字节来存储)遇到可以强制转化,把long前面加上(),再写类型 3. 转换不同类型例子(Sting--->Int) 这里把不同类型做强转,每一个基本类型都有一个大型的全称 int-->Integer 注意转化类型的全称大写, parse转换类型 在进行强制类型转换时,如果要转换的数据类型不能转换为目标数据类型,则会抛出ClassCastException 异常。因此,在进行强制类型转换时,应该确保转换是有效的并且不会导致数据丢失或异常。